基于无源智能锁的高铁栅栏门远程控制系统的研发

Remote control system of high-speed railway gate based on passive intelligent lock

  • 摘要: 针对目前高铁栅栏门机械锁具及管理模式存在的问题,设计研发了基于无源智能锁的高铁栅栏门远程控制系统,阐述了系统方案选择、总体架构、软硬件构成、基本工作流程及系统功能。应用效果表明,系统具有申请授权简单便捷,运行稳定可靠的特点,能有效消除高铁栅栏门的安全管理盲区,实现高铁栅栏门的智能化、网络化、信息化管理。

     

    Abstract: Aiming at the problems of mechanical lock and management mode of high-speed railway gate, this article designed and developed a remote control system of high-speed railway gate based on passive intelligent lock, described the selection of system scheme, overall architecture, composition of software and hardware, basic workflow and system functions. The application results show that the system has the characteristics of simple and convenient application and authorization, stable and reliable operation, which can effectively eliminate the blind area of safety management of high-speed railway gate, and implement the intelligent, network and information management of highspeed railway gate.
